Chris Pratt shares emotional message, video about son Jack

Chris Pratt and his wife, Anna Faris, welcomed their now four-year-old son Jack into the world as premature baby and on World Premature Day the actor took to Instagram to share a cute video of his son.
Jack was only three pounds at the time of birth but has now grown up to become a perfectly healthy and happy little boy.
"As many of you may know, our son Jack was just over 3 pounds when he was born. Thanks to scientific advances made possible by #marchofdimes funding, today he's a perfectly healthy, curious 4 year old," Pratt wrote captioning the video of his son playing with a Praying Mantis.
The 37-year-old actor, who has been supporting a lot of NGO's working to end premature birth, birth defects and infant mortality, asked his fans to join him in the cause.
"Today is #worldprematurityday. 15 million babies are born #prematurely each year around the world. And 1 million of them won't live to celebrate their 1st #birthday.
"The @marchofdimes strives for a world where every #baby has a fair chance, yet this is not the reality for many mothers and babies. Join me in supporting their efforts to give every baby a fighting chance by clicking the link in my bio.
